Oh, Kamakiri, I bet you'd probably have something similar to the one I just posted today, if you don't mind, would you please take a quick look on what I have and share your thoughts on it's exact naming?

Pretty sure it's a 'Camper' 234U.  That's the name that was used in the catalogs I  know of before and after that time frame. I generally think if it has a 5 twist CS that it's a Camper. 4 twist, and that's about the time that Campers got the saws c. '73/'74.

Yours is from '57+ and is probably at least '58+ with the 'v2' +PAT.  I'd have to see more of the knife to estimate how much later it might be.
